Germany, Wehrmacht. An Infantry Assault Badge In Silver certificate_of_authenticity (with "Eberts Field(Infanterie Sturmabzeichen in Silber). Constructed of silvered feinzink, the obverse consisting of an oval oak leaf wreath, with a German national eagle clutching a mobile swastika on the top and a bowtie on the bottom, diagonally across the badge is a Karabiner 98k with the bayonet attached to the front of the barrel and the carrying sling hanging from the rifle, the reverse with a barrel hinge and vertical pinback meeting a round wire catch,
